Key Responsibilities
- General Contract and Subcontract administration
- Monitor/document jobsite safety and accident prevention
- Construction scheduling
- Procurement and expediting of material and equipment
- Mechanical, electrical and piping systems coordination
- Shop drawing/submittal review and coordination
- Project cost review, reporting, updating and accounting
- Review of subcontractor applications for payment
- Participation in/documentation of project coordination meetings
- Supervision/coordination of subcontractors’ field installations
- Review/negotiate change proposal pricing from subcontractors and prepare change proposal pricing for self-performed work
- Change order documentation and associated cost reporting and maintenance
- Research and suggest options on construction means, methods and equipment
- Maintenance of As-Built plans
- Quality control and project closeout
- Implement all applicable safety and EEO/Affirmative Action programs on project
Skills & Qualifications
- Bachelor’s Degree in Construction Management, Civil Engineering, Mechanical Engineering or related engineering degree
- Construction internship or other related construction work experience preferred
- General knowledge of construction principles/practices required
- Must be geographically mobile and able to relocate within a region
- Strong work ethic and desire to work in a team environment
